In 2026, Albania sees a significant rise in A/B testing adoption, with 65% of businesses actively optimizing their websites and apps. This shift reflects a growing digital maturity, driven by increased internet penetration and the need for competitive edge. The average conversion rate of 4.8% indicates improved effectiveness of online strategies, supported by targeted UX improvements and data-driven decision-making.
User experience remains a priority, with a UX satisfaction score of 78 out of 100. Mobile engagement is high, at 62%, emphasizing the importance of mobile-optimized design. The digital economy continues to grow, contributing approximately €420 million ($470 million) in revenue, demonstrating Albania's expanding online market and the importance of ongoing UX and testing investments.
